On 28 February 2023, Noxolo submitted her second provisional tax return for her 2023 year of assessment and paid an amount of R191 576.
She was 34 years old at the time. She estimated her taxable income for the 2023 year of assessment at R1 190 000 and used that estimated amount to determine her second provisional tax payment.
Her basic amount was R1 180 000.
Her first provisional tax payment was made on 31 August 2022 amounting to R189 000.
On 15 November 2023, she received her assessment for the 2023 year of assessment, which indicated her final assessed taxable income for the year as R1 670 000.
---Discuss whether Noxolo is liable for an underpayment penalty, as per par 20 in the Income Tax Act, regarding her estimated taxable income used for the purpose of her second provisional tax return.
---Assume Noxolo is liable for an underpayment penalty, calculate the amount of the penalty.
